The Polish School of Animation at the KF, Day 1
Friday, October 10, 2014, at 7:00pm
The Polish School of Animation project aspires to give international recognition to the more-than-fifty-years-old output of Polish animation. The program is composed in such a way that the first screening (1959-1981) brings back classical achievements of Polish animation, while the next three present productions of a younger generations of artists who have made their debuts more recently.
Day 1 Screening Program (87′)
- Dom/House, dir. Walerian Borowczyk, Jan Lenica (1958, 11′)
- Labirynt/Labyrinth, dir. Jan Lenica (1961, 14’15”)
- Czerwone i czarne/Red and Black, dir. Witold Giersz (1963, 6’30”)
- Wszystko jest liczbą/Everything Is a Number, dir. Stefan Schabenbeck (1966, 7’30”)
- Hobby, dir. Daniel Szczechura (1968, 7′)
- Apel/The Roll-Call, dir. Ryszard Czekała (1970,7’15”)
- Droga/Road, dir. Mirosław Kijowicz (1971, 4’30”)
- Bankiet/The Banquet, dir. Zofia Oraczewska (1976, 8’15”)
- Refleksy/Reflection, dir. Jerzy Kucia (1979, 6′)
- Tango, dir. Zbigniew Rybczyński (1980, 8′)
- Solo na ugorze/ Solo in a Fallow Field, dir. Jerzy Kalina (1981, 7′)
This screening is a part of the project “Polish School of Animation – Next Generations” organized by Stowarzyszenie Rotunda /International Film Festival Etiuda&Anima/ and with the support of The Ministry of Culture and National Heritage of The Republic of Poland and the Polish Film Institute.
